Reporting from one week post-op. All 4 extracted under general anesthesia with PRP. I’m 35/F and was told probably 12 years ago that they should come out 🙃 bottom two were bone impacted.

I had my follow up yesterday and they flushed the holes and said everything looks great and I’m clear to eat whatever I want, just keeping flushing holes until they close(probably a month of so).

Today I ate eggs and toast(skipped the crust), chicken pot pie, and a cheeseburger with potato salad! Also beer, wine, coffee, and sparkling water.

Irrigating is still really gross to me because I can’t tell how big the holes are and stuff always comes out after I eat but they don’t really bother me. Just feels weird in my mouth there now and a little uncomfortable/dull ache after irrigating. But I’m gonna have to get over it because this is my life until they close.

The beginning really sucked, I was getting a little depressed for not being able to eat properly, but just here to say there is a light at the end of the tunnel!
